  • How is the weather in Domodossola?

    Domodossola has cold winters, with January temperatures around 22–34°F (-5–1°C), and mild summers, usually 50–69°F (10–20°C) in July. Rain is frequent in spring and fall, so a waterproof layer comes in handy.

  • What are the best places to visit in Domodossola?

    Popular places include the Piazza del Mercato, the Sacro Monte Calvario, and the Collegiate Church of Saints Gervasio and Protasio. Many visitors also explore artisan shops and museums tucked along ancient alleyways.

  • What is Domodossola known for?

    Domodossola is known for its medieval Old Town, vibrant weekly markets, and scenic location at the foot of the Alps. The town has a tradition of artisanal foods, and its historic squares host community events and gatherings.

  • What are the best foods to try in Domodossola?

    Domodossola’s cuisine includes hearty polenta, locally cured meats, mountain cheeses, and rustic breads. Sample gnocchi with regional sauces, and taste traditional pastries or artisanal gelato for dessert.
